I would need to create new TCP ports in CSM to be able to increase the timeout (24 hrs or 86400 sec)
Would it work if I create a new inspect? is it the best way of doing this?
I know we cannot use the "timeout con" attribute (because it will modify ALL TCP timeouts)

Yes that is what you want to do. You don't want to change the tcp global timeout.
It will be put in a new class map under a policy map.
It is the "set connection" option under the class-map.
It is under setting the Modular Policy Framework options for connections in CSM.

I have played with Inspects (Inspection Rules), I have found out that I am limited to 12 hrs as a MAX timeout.
So if I understand correctly, the only way I can configure a single TCP port with a timeout of 24hrs is to configure a MPF ( Modular Policy Framework)
Am I correct?

Yes, you are correct.
to change timeouts for specific tcp ports you need MPF.
